功能介紹放開頭, 使用便捷無(wú)需愁。
這是全網(wǎng)最詳細(xì)、性價(jià)比最高的STM32實(shí)戰(zhàn)項(xiàng)目入門教程,通過(guò)合理的硬件設(shè)計(jì)和詳細(xì)的視頻筆記介紹,硬件使用STM32F103主控資料多方便學(xué)習(xí),通過(guò)3萬(wàn)字筆記、12多個(gè)小時(shí)視頻、20多章節(jié)代碼手把手教會(huì)你如何開發(fā)和調(diào)試。讓你更快掌握嵌入式系統(tǒng)開發(fā)。
這個(gè)是全網(wǎng)最詳細(xì)的STM32項(xiàng)目教學(xué)視頻。
第一篇[在這里:]
視頻在這里:
[video(video-ciRhnAjH-1716826735659)(type-bilibili)(url-https://player.bilibili.com/player.html?aid=990827294)(image-https://img-blog.csdnimg.cn/img_convert/b85b26803ca2702ff803960d46f7073f.png)(title-STM32智能小車V3-STM32入門教程-openmv與STM32循跡小車-stm32f103c8t6-電賽 嵌入式學(xué)習(xí) PID控制算法 編碼器電機(jī) 跟隨)]
20.1-電磁桿原理講解
講解電磁循跡原理
紅外循跡賽道中間是黑色膠帶,視覺(jué)循跡賽道中間是特定顏色膠帶,而電磁循跡賽道中間是一根通這20khz正弦交流信號(hào)的銅線。
電磁桿要能供感知告訴現(xiàn)在相對(duì)銅線的位置,以便于小車完成循跡。
那么如何才能感應(yīng)到通有正弦交流信號(hào)的銅線位置那? 我們使用電感,因?yàn)橥ㄓ姓医涣餍盘?hào)的銅線會(huì)在周圍產(chǎn)生磁場(chǎng),而電感里面的線圈在這樣的磁場(chǎng)下就會(huì)產(chǎn)生電壓電流( 電磁感應(yīng)定律 ),我們對(duì)這個(gè)電壓進(jìn)行放大和濾波,最后通過(guò)檢測(cè)這個(gè)電壓就可以判定小車在磁場(chǎng)中的相對(duì)位置。
使用LC諧振電路
電感的線圈會(huì)在磁場(chǎng)中獲得感應(yīng)電流,然后LC并聯(lián)諧振電路對(duì)感應(yīng)電動(dòng)勢(shì)進(jìn)行 選頻 。
LC諧振電路的諧振頻率公式
并聯(lián)諧振電感的值為10 mH,并聯(lián)諧振電容的值為6.8 nF。L為諧振電感的電感值;C為并聯(lián)諧振電容的電容值。通過(guò)計(jì)算可得fC約為19.3 kHz。
這里增加示波器測(cè)量 LC的波形和只有電感的波形
這是原理圖和PCB中LC諧振電路的焊接位置
使用放大電路
我們采集到的電壓范圍為50mv-200mv之間,要讓單片機(jī)采集到的更加精確,我們選擇將其放大到伏特V的范圍。51單片機(jī)不超過(guò)5V,stm32不超過(guò)3.3V。簡(jiǎn)單說(shuō)就是將將信號(hào)放大點(diǎn),我們用運(yùn)放實(shí)現(xiàn)放大。
我們這里使用芯片是OPA2350UA
這是原理圖
關(guān)于運(yùn)放的原理和大概使用說(shuō)明可以看工科男孫老師的教程 :[電子小白學(xué)不會(huì)運(yùn)放?一開始掌握這兩個(gè)用法就夠了!_嗶哩嗶哩_bilibili]
[添加鏈接描述]
使用檢波電路
使用二極管檢波電路將交變的電壓信號(hào)檢波形成直流信號(hào),然后再通過(guò)單片機(jī)的 AD 采集獲得正比于感應(yīng)電壓幅值的數(shù)值。
使用兩個(gè)二極管進(jìn)行倍壓檢波,可以獲得正比于交流電壓信號(hào)峰峰值的直流信號(hào)。為了能夠獲得更大的動(dòng)態(tài)范圍, 倍壓檢波電路中的二極管推薦使用開啟電壓較小的肖特基二極管。
我們使用BAT54S搭建檢波電路
具體原理和一些相關(guān)測(cè)試仿真可以從這篇文章學(xué)習(xí)[小信號(hào)SOT23封裝的肖特基二極管BAT54s_bat54s整流電路-CSDN博客]
最后信號(hào)輸出,通過(guò)我們的端口輸出,可以把單片機(jī)已經(jīng)設(shè)置好ADC功能的引腳接到電磁循跡的端口上。
參考這篇文章:[智能車:這是你要找的電磁桿嗎?_電磁桿電路-CSDN博客]
[添加鏈接描述]
這里給大家提供的一個(gè)運(yùn)放電路+檢波電路的整理原理圖
首先D 芯片里面兩個(gè)運(yùn)放,所以芯片D原理圖等效C部分,
A部分中使用了D芯片的一個(gè)運(yùn)放。
然后根據(jù)A部分的原理圖,整理就是B 部分,A部分和B部分是等效的,這樣結(jié)合運(yùn)放和檢波電路原理就非常容易理解了。
審核編輯 黃宇
-
STM32
+關(guān)注
關(guān)注
2270文章
10895瀏覽量
355715 -
電磁
+關(guān)注
關(guān)注
15文章
1133瀏覽量
51793 -
PID
+關(guān)注
關(guān)注
35文章
1472瀏覽量
85475 -
循跡
+關(guān)注
關(guān)注
0文章
14瀏覽量
13061
發(fā)布評(píng)論請(qǐng)先 登錄
相關(guān)推薦
評(píng)論